What clients expect and what professionals need to know
Paint removal methods include chemical stripping with methylene-chloride-free gel or citrus-based strippers, heat guns for flat surfaces, and mechanical methods (orbital sanders, angle grinders with wire cups) for exterior wood siding. Lead paint removal in pre-1978 homes requires EPA RRP certified contractors using containment, wet methods to suppress dust, HEPA vacuums, and licensed hazardous waste disposal of chips and dust. Chemical strippers are applied, allowed to dwell, then scraped while wet.

Common questions from clients looking for Paint Removal services
Homes built before 1978 may contain lead paint; homes pre-1940 almost certainly do. 3M LeadCheck swabs provide a quick field test; XRF testing by a certified lead inspector gives a comprehensive assessment.
Intact lead paint poses minimal risk; deteriorating, peeling, or chalking lead paint creates dust and chips that are highly toxic, especially to children under 6 years old.
Methylene-chloride-free gel strippers (Dumond Smart Strip, Citristrip) are safer for interior use; apply generously, cover with plastic sheeting to extend dwell time, and scrape wet for best results.
Avoid heat guns near leaded glass and near glazing compound — heat can crack glass and melt modern glazing. Chemical strippers are safer for window trim detail work.
Post lead warning signs, use plastic sheeting containment, wet-scrape or use HEPA sanding tools, HEPA vacuum all surfaces, and properly dispose of lead-contaminated waste — all documented in a project record.
